A Cornish sailing charity is launching a recruitment drive with a difference – to find a military veteran to join them on a section of a challenge to sail around the British Isles.
A crew of seventeen injured veterans – many with little or no sailing experience – set sail on a tall ship from Falmouth in Cornwall on August 5 on the Turn to Starboard Round Britain Challenge. So far the team has battled huge waves and clocked up more than 400 miles sailing up clockwise up the West coast.
Now the charity is calling out for a crew member also affected by military operations to join them on the epic journey, whether for a shorter section or the rest of the route.
